Technical Specifications for General Electric Thhqb32035
The General Electric Thhqb32035 is a three-publish electrical transfer with a 35-ampere rating. It works at a voltage of 240V AC and is supposed for use in each private and commercial enterprise settings. The breaker highlights warm attractive excursion devices for precise coverage and brief response to electrical flaws.
Breakdown of Electrical Ratings
- Current Rating: 35 Amperes
- Voltage Rating: 240 Volts AC
- Number of Poles: 3
- Trip Unit Type: Thermal-Magnetic
- Interrupting Rating: 10 kAIC (kiloamperes interrupting capacity)
Physical Dimensions and Design Features
- Height: 3.28 inches
- Width: 3.0 inches
- Depth: 2.75 inches
- Weight: Approximately 1.5 pounds
- Mounting Type: Plug-In

User Guides and Tutorials
Step-by-Step Installation Guide
- Turn Off Power: Ensure the power is turned off at the main breaker.
- Remove Panel Cover: Carefully remove the panel cover to access the circuit breaker slots.
- Insert the Breaker: Align the THHQB32035 with the slot and firmly push it into place.
- Connect Wires: Connect the load wires to the breaker terminals and tighten securely.
- Replace Panel Cover: Reattach the panel cover and turn on the main breaker.
- Test the Breaker: Test the breaker to guarantee it is working accurately.
Maintenance Tips for Prolonging Lifespan
- Regular Inspections: Direct standard examinations to check for any indications of wear or harm.
- Clean Contacts: Keep the breaker contacts spotless and liberated from garbage.
- Check Connections: Guarantee all electrical associations are tight and secure.
- Test Regularly: Intermittently test the breaker to guarantee it trips accurately under shortcoming conditions.
Troubleshooting Common Issues
- Breaker Not Tripping: Check for proper installation and ensure the load is within the breaker’s capacity.
- Frequent Tripping: Investigate potential overloads or short circuits in the system.
- Physical Damage: Replace the breaker if there are any visible signs of physical damage.
